Description

The City of Anaheim's Finance Department is seeking a proactive and detail-oriented Budget Analyst (Budget Analyst II or Senior Budget Analyst) to engage in a range of professional tasks related to the formulation, assessment, and oversight of municipal budgets. The Budget Analyst will play a crucial role in coordinating budgetary processes with designated City departments and personnel. Responsibilities include:

  • Conducting comprehensive financial analyses and providing management support.
  • Preparing and delivering presentations using PowerPoint, and actively participating in community and commission meetings.
  • Executing operational audits and productivity assessments.
  • Reviewing and forecasting citywide General Fund revenues, including various tax revenues.
  • Conducting research and analysis in financial planning and operational processes.

Candidates should have a minimum of two years of relevant experience in budget preparation and monitoring, along with a Bachelor's degree in finance, accounting, business administration, public administration, or a related field. An equivalent combination of experience and education that meets the essential job functions is acceptable. Ideal candidates will have experience in government agency budget analysis, including revenue and expenditure forecasting, and proficiency in ERP financial systems such as CGI, Oracle, Peoplesoft, or SAP, as well as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, Word, PowerPoint).

Position Characteristics:
The Budget Analyst II represents the full journey level within the Budget Analyst series, distinguished by the ability to perform a comprehensive range of assigned duties with minimal supervision.

The Senior Budget Analyst is recognized as the advanced journey level, responsible for the most complex and demanding tasks within the series, requiring extensive training and expertise in all related procedures.

Budget Analyst II Essential Functions
  • Facilitate and engage in the collaborative efforts of staff involved in the development and monitoring of operating and capital budgets.
  • Review and recommend budget proposals for assigned departments to upper management.
  • Identify and address budgetary and financial challenges, providing accurate financial analysis.
  • Assist in the production of financial and budget reports for citywide and departmental use.
  • Monitor departmental budgets to ensure compliance with financial guidelines.

Senior Budget Analyst Essential Functions
  • Lead the development and coordination of policies for the budget process.
  • Conduct complex financial analyses and serve as a liaison between departmental management teams.
  • Participate in the creation and dissemination of budget documents.
  • Oversee the maintenance of the City's online budget system.
  • Design and implement training programs for financial systems.

Qualifications:

Budget Analyst II Qualifications
Experience and Education: Two years of experience in budget preparation and monitoring, supplemented by a Bachelor's degree in finance, accounting, business administration, public administration, or a related field.

Senior Budget Analyst Qualifications
Experience and Education: Three years of experience in budget preparation and monitoring, supplemented by a Bachelor's degree in finance, accounting, business administration, public administration, or a related field.
